Chris 87 left this review about Wibbas Down Inn (JD Wetherspoon)
Standard JDW joint - big, spacious, entertaining some 'characters' and cheap ale. Not much to say about this really, had a pint of Sharp's Nadelik which was adequate, although it took ages to get served on New Years Day with one member of staff behind the massive bar. Not very smart if you ask me, or other disgruntled punters.

Just a quick pint, then I'm off left this review about Wibbas Down Inn (JD Wetherspoon)
Very unprepossessingly-looking building, and a fairly standard 'spoons interior with the ambience not helped by the low ceiling in the front section. However, with some 17 festival real ales on at the bargain price of £1.69 one really shouldn't complain too much. The beer was fine, the tables clear and the bar service was efficient too. The toilets were disgusting, though...

Pub SignMan left this review about Wibbas Down Inn (JD Wetherspoon)
This has to be just about the most bland Weatherspoons pub I've ever been in. The beers are okay, but nothing out of the ordinary, whilst the grudging, unsmiling service is perhaps the only thing that sets this apart from other pubs in their chain.
